Output 51b220b1da36da92f7b4e41c923e124388b44a8514f58ea25714faaa56bbe68d:4

value
156350
script pubkey
OP_0 OP_PUSHBYTES_20 cd3aa88c31bdee995bcaa77e72a996d4c0b0be4e
address
bc1qe5a23rp3hhhfjk725al892vk6nqtp0jw4572d3
transaction
51b220b1da36da92f7b4e41c923e124388b44a8514f58ea25714faaa56bbe68d
spent
true